Job Description

Overview

Banyan Global Introduction: Banyan Global is a women-owned development consulting firm founded on the principle that integrating expertise and experience from the development community and private sector will achieve a broad and lasting impact. Our unique team comprises seasoned private sector and international development professionals. Headquartered in Washington D.C. Banyan Global maintains staff around the world.

Banyan Global is seeking a full-time Canberra-based Operations Manager for an anticipated Gender Equality Disability and Social Inclusion (GEDSI)-focused DFAT project. The Operations Manager will play a pivotal role in supporting the effective delivery and execution of all project deliverables. The role will focus on planning coordination and administration across technical financial and operational functions ensuring seamless collaboration between stakeholders. This role requires a deep commitment to ensuring principles of gender quality disability and social inclusion are integrated into all aspects of operations. The Operations Manager will support the Team Leader in promoting a culture of respect and team cohesion

Responsibilities

  • Provide leadership coordination and quality assurance of program enabling and support functions including finance administration human resources management IT support risk management and security
  • Lead on procurement processes ensuring alignment with Commonwealth Procurement Rules (CPR) as well as Banyan Globals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) ensuring processes deliver value for money and inclusive outcomes.
  • Work with the Banyan Global team to implement and update the Operational policies and procedures as outlines in the Operations Manual Program Security Plans Standard Operating Procedures Crisis and Emergency Plan Emergency Response Procedures for all aspects of the program operations.
  • Ensure all new staff and advisers are thoroughly and regularly briefed on safety and security procedures.
  • Management of the Program budget in line with the Annual Work Plan (AWP) for the Program.
  • Ensure program compliance with relevant policies procedures laws and regulations including DFAT and Banyan Global. Serve as the primary contact point between corporate services and the Program for operational and compliance matters.
  • Lead financial functions including authorization/review of payment approval forms invoices reports and other documents using various software tools
  • Develop and manage detailed program budgets including accurate forecasting and financial reporting.
  • Ensure project finance processes and procedures for program budgeting forecasting bank account management reconciliation and invoicing are implemented accurately and effectively.
  • Ensure financial operations comply with DFAT Banyan Global and Government requirements.
  • Lead and oversight on the procurement and contract management function of the program. Perform project procurements as per the procurement policies and donor regulations including maintaining vendor lists solicitation of quotations/proposals and documentation of procurement decisions and contracts and managing vendor relationships
  • Conduct due diligence and facilitate any necessary safeguarding checks and/or training required to establish contractual relationships with contractors sub-contractors and other service providers.
  • Assist the Team Leader with the management public diplomacy and preparation of communication products and provide inputs where able in line with DFATs expectations and standards.

Qualifications

  • Bachelors Degree and 10 years of experience Masters degree and 8 years of experience or equivalent combination of education and experience in Business Administration Management Finance or Accounting or related field.
  • Ten (10) years of progressively responsible experience and expertise in the implementation of large and complex DFAT-funded investments.
  • Demonstrated experience in operations management corporate administration or a similar role.
  • Strong understanding of workplan development and program coordination preferably in DFAT/donor-funded development programs.
  • Proven ability to manage financial administrative and logistical functions within complex programs.
  • A demonstrated track record engaging experts organizations and institutions from diverse backgrounds based in target regions.
  • Knowledgeable and experienced with DFAT contracting policies and procedures.
  • Strong leadership skills including demonstrated skills in building mobilizing and leading multidisciplinary teams.
  • Proven ability to work under pressure and with multiple concurrent demands.
  • Strong ability to work across technical and operational areas.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• English language skills required. First Nations and/or visual languages encouraged.
